thanks for listening. i love mixing as much as i love writing and playing, so i take a great deal of pride in that.
actually, upon listening again, i can hear that during mastering i went a little too hot at the peak of the song and got some crunchiness going on. ah well, psychoacoustically, it makes it seem that much louder.

12parsecs
i'm glad i'm here at mj too! it's been a lot of fun listening and sharing. it's just the kick in the ass i needed to start finishing off some of my works in progress.
and the build... since it's specific instruments i want brought up at specific times, i had to write a lot of volume automation to achieve this. it was a lot more work than i anticipated. thanks for the comment!
